MUJI renews its smartphone app in early September. Points can now be earned and donated at checkout.

Ryohin Keikaku, which operates MUJI, will change the name of its smartphone application “MUJI passport” to “MUJI appli” and implement a complete renewal of the application in early September. Details of the new application are scheduled to be released in early August.

MUJI passport launched its service in May 2013. The application is free to download and use, and the number of annual active users in Japan exceeds 15.69 million (September 2023 – end of August).

The concept of the renewal is “Meet ‘just right’. Your partner for your life. The app itself becomes a membership card, and points are directly awarded when presented at the time of checkout. The design has been completely redesigned from the previous application, allowing users to more intuitively obtain the information they want and use the online store.

The “MUJI Miles Service” offered within the app will also be renewed as the new “MUJI GOOD PROGRAM”.

Whereas the existing “MUJI Miles Service” awards points that can be used at checkout when a certain number of miles are accumulated, the new “MUJI GOOD PROGRAM” allows customers to use their points to make donations for disaster relief and reconstruction assistance.
